The Pelonis Digital Fan Forced Heater is designed to provide efficient heating for small to medium-sized rooms. It features a digital thermostat, multiple heat settings, and a fan-forced design that ensures even heat distribution. Safety features include overheat protection and a tip-over switch. | Symptom | Possible Cause | Corrective Action |
|---|---|---|
| Heater does not turn on | No power | Check power outlet and cord. |
| Heater is not heating | Incorrect setting | Ensure heat setting is selected. |
| Overheating | Blocked air intake | Check for obstructions and clean. |
| Tip-over switch activated | Heater tipped over | Place heater upright and reset. |
Reset: Unplug for 10 seconds and plug back in.
